Thrills and Tranquility
The heart of the desert offered a thrilling escape from the ordinary. Our first taste of adventure was dune bashing, a heart-pounding ride across the shifting sands in a 4x4 Land Cruiser. Asif’s expert handling of the vehicle made the experience exhilarating yet safe. The adrenaline rush was palpable, and the laughter shared with my wife was a testament to the joy of the moment.
After the excitement of dune bashing, we took a moment to appreciate the desert’s tranquility. The vastness of the landscape, with its endless horizon, was a humbling sight. We tried our hand at sandboarding, gliding down the dunes with the wind in our hair. It was a playful reminder of the simple joys that nature offers.
Camel riding was another highlight, providing a glimpse into the traditional way of life in the desert. As we swayed gently atop these majestic creatures, I couldn’t help but reflect on the resilience and adaptability of the Bedouin people who have thrived in this harsh environment for centuries.
A Cultural Feast
As the sun dipped below the horizon, we arrived at the desert camp, where a feast of cultural experiences awaited us. The evening was a celebration of Arabian heritage, with live entertainment that included a mesmerizing Tanoura dance, a captivating belly dance, and a thrilling fire show. Each performance was a testament to the rich artistic traditions of the region.
The culinary offerings were equally impressive. We indulged in a sumptuous BBQ dinner, savoring the flavors of the Middle East. The meal was a delightful blend of spices and textures, a fitting tribute to the region’s culinary heritage.
